2462-20 M12 impact driver

Cordless Drilling & fastening Impact driver M12

The 2462-20 is a cordless electric impact driver manufactured by Milwaukee.

It has a brushed electric motor powered by a 12 volt M12 battery.

The machine shares the same user manual with the 2461-20 and 2463-20 impact wrenches. The tools share same body and functions with a have a different drive type and maximum IPM and RPM.

Exterior

The machine has a plastic red body with black rubberized around the handle and back side.

The handle is placed in the middle of the body for better balance. An M12 battery is inserted in the bottom of the handle. This makes the machine more compact than similar tools where the battery is placed under the handle but also makes the handle wider.

On top of the handle is a black trigger switch with an LED light above it that illuminates the working area. Behind it is a black push button to reverse the direction of rotation on each side.

Behind it are four LEDs on the left side that act as a battery charge indicator. Milwaukee calls this the "fuel gauge".

The motor housing has a metal belt clip on the back that can be placed on either side.

At the front there is a bare aluminum hammer case that is a bit larger most other 12V impact drivers. At the very front is a black 1/4" hex bit holder.

Operation

The machine is activated by pulling the black variable speed trigger switch. The turning direction can be reversed with the button behind it.

The bit can be removed by pulling the sleeve around the bit holder forward.
